工程设计网

位置:网站首页 > 建筑结构设计 > 框架结构设计 > 框架结构的适用范围有哪些

框架结构设计

框架结构的适用范围有哪些

工程设计网 2023-08-03 框架结构设计 0
引言框架结构是软件开发中常用的一种架构设计方法,它跨越各个领域,包括Web应用程序、移动应用程序和桌面应用程序等。多种软件开发框架都使用该方法,例如:Spring、Ruby on Rails和Djan

引言

框架结构是软件开发中常用的一种架构设计方法,它跨越各个领域,包括Web应用程序、移动应用程序和桌面应用程序等。多种软件开发框架都使用该方法,例如:Spring、Ruby on Rails和Django。本文将探讨框架结构的适用范围以及如何选择合适的框架。

主体

1. 框架结构的适用范围

框架结构的适用范围有哪些

框架结构适用于大型软件项目的开发,尤其是需要跨团队上下文开展的软件项目。通常,框架结构使用模块化的方法对软件进行划分和组织,使得开发人员可以同时进行工作。另外,框架结构也适用于开发具有模块化设计的中型软件项目,这些项目的组件可以通过框架结构组织起来,以便于开发和维护。

2. 框架结构的优点

框架结构具有许多优点,使其成为大型软件项目开发中最受欢迎的架构设计方法之一。首先,框架的组件化结构为开发人员提供了一个一致的设计框架,使得每个组织的开发人员都可以按照一条路线进行开发,避免了功能重复。此外,框架结构的另一个优点是它可以提供更好的代码可重用性,这意味着开发人员可以节省时间和精力,在不同的项目中重用他们的代码。同样,框架结构也大大减少了维护时间和开发成本,因为框架的设计和组织使得组件可以进行分布式部署和管理。

3. 如何选择合适的框架

选择合适的框架结构是成功开发一个软件项目的关键之一。当决定使用框架结构时,开发人员需要考虑许多因素。首先,应该考虑框架的支持,即该框架的文档和论坛等服务是否充分,社区是否支持。其次,在选择框架时,应该考虑其使用的难度。对于简单的项目,一个较简单的框架可能更加合适,而对于复杂的项目,则需要一个强大的、可扩展的框架。最后,开发人员还应该考虑框架的兼容性。选择框架时必须注意,框架支持的技术,包括语言、数据库、浏览器,与您的项目技术是否兼容。

结论

框架结构是一种在软件开发中广泛使用的架构设计方法,它适用于大型、中型和小型的软件项目,能够提高软件的设计能力和组织能力、减轻开发和维护的负担。在选择框架时,开发人员应该考虑框架的支持、使用难度和兼容性等因素。只有适合的框架被选择,软件开发才能更加高效、快速、稳定。

建筑资质代办专业顾问:

赵经理

13198516101